Output 5057520598ceddb8fb1b6de2754140083c5db34596829b0146dfde5094caea30:2

value
2025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6955263c41d96a91fa5cccdc54c41d8fbdf123ea OP_EQUAL
address
A23Dcp76kG1qmxojnJKtCGmm24GjGJ5tgH
transaction
5057520598ceddb8fb1b6de2754140083c5db34596829b0146dfde5094caea30